Investigators probing the alleged murder of Pune businessman Ketan Agarwal have uncovered claims that the family of the main accused, Siya Goyal, allegedly demanded Rs10 crore from the victim before their planned marriage.
According to police, the alleged demand surfaced during discussions between the two families ahead of the wedding. Investigators are examining whether the financial dispute was linked to the events that ultimately led to the alleged murder.
Police are also investigating the role of co-accused Chetan Chaudhary, who is alleged to have been in a relationship with Siya Goyal. Investigators believe the two conspired to kill Ketan after the marriage plans continued despite their alleged relationship.
The case relates to the death of Ketan Agarwal at Lohagad Fort, where police allege he was pushed into a gorge in a pre-planned attack.
Authorities are analysing digital evidence, financial records and witness statements as part of the ongoing investigation. No formal conclusions have yet been reached regarding the alleged Rs10 crore demand, and the probe remains under way.
